KNSA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2018 in Review

52 of the 4,505 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Kiniksa Pharmaceuticals (KNSA) for Q4 2018, worth a combined $385M — up 6.2% from $363M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 12 funds closed out of KNSA and 9 opened new positions — a net loss of 3 holders — while 15 trimmed existing stakes and 15 added.

The largest buyer was Vanguard Group, adding an estimated $7.35M. The largest seller was Hillhouse Investment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$35.4M sold.
